All Products

Categories
Out of stock
View As
Sort by:
Show items
Items 19 to 25 of 25 total
1 2 3
  In stock
$3,560.31
  In stock
$360.28
  In stock
$58.17 $53.41
  In stock
$46.30
  In stock
$58.17
  In stock
$1,547.45
  In stock
$411.90
Add to cart
Items 19 to 25 of 25 total
1 2 3